Superpriority Senior Secured Debtor-In-Possession ABL Facility
Commitment Letter

 

Ladies and Gentlemen:

 

Tailored Brands, Inc., The Men’s Wearhouse, Inc. and Moores The Suit People Corp. (collectively, “Tailored”, “you” or “your”) have (i) advised the parties listed on the signature pages hereto as Commitment Parties (each, a “Commitment Party” and, collectively, the “Commitment Parties”, “we”, “us” or “our”), that Tailored and certain of its subsidiaries (the “Subsidiary Debtors” and, collectively with Tailored, the “Debtors”), are considering filing voluntary petitions for relief under Chapter 11 of Title 11 of the United States Code, 11 U.S.C. §§ 101 et seq. (as amended, the “Bankruptcy Code”), and (ii) in connection with the foregoing, requested that the Commitment Parties agree to commit to provide a $500,000,000 superpriority secured debtor-in-possession credit facility for Tailored under Sections 364(c) and 364(d) of the Bankruptcy Code (the “DIP Facility”) subject solely to the conditions set forth in Section 5 below and in Article IV of the Form DIP Credit Agreement (as defined below). The DIP Facility will convert, subject solely to the satisfaction of the applicable conditions precedent set forth in the section titled “Conditions Precedent to the Conversion Date” in the Exit Facility Term Sheet (as defined in the Form DIP Credit Agreement), to a senior secured, asset based revolving credit facility on the Conversion Date (as defined in Form DIP Credit Agreement) (the “Exit Revolving Facility”), which terms and conditions will be memorialized in a credit agreement that will govern the Exit Revolving Facility substantially on the terms set forth in the Exit Facility Term Sheet. Unless otherwise specified herein, all references to “$” shall refer to U.S. dollars. Capitalized terms used herein without definition shall have the meaning assigned thereto in the Form DIP Credit Agreement.

 

1.                   Commitment.

 

To provide assurance that the DIP Facility and the Exit Revolving Facility shall be available on the terms and conditions set forth herein and in the Form DIP Credit Agreement and the Exit Facility Term Sheet, as applicable, each Commitment Party (in such capacity, an “Initial Lender”) is pleased to advise Tailored of its commitment (the “Commitment”) to provide, itself or through one or more funds managed by such Commitment Party, the amount of the DIP Facility and Exit Revolving Facility, each as set forth on Schedule 1 hereto, on the terms set forth in the form Senior Secured Super-Priority Debtor-In-Possession Credit Agreement attached hereto as Exhibit A (the “Form DIP Credit Agreement”, and together with this letter, the “Commitment Letter”), subject solely to the conditions set forth in Section 5 below, in Article IV of the Form DIP Credit Agreement and the section titled “Conditions Precedent to the Conversion Date” in the Exit Facility Term Sheet that are applicable to the relevant facility. It is understood and agreed that the commitments of the Commitment Parties under this Commitment Letter shall be several and not joint.

2.                   Syndication.

 

You hereby appoint JPMorgan Chase Bank, N.A. (“JPMCB”) (in such capacity, the “Lead Arranger”) to act, and the Lead Arranger hereby agrees to act, as sole lead arranger and sole bookrunner for the DIP Facility and the Exit Revolving Facility upon the terms set forth in this Commitment Letter.

 

It is agreed that (a) JPMCB shall serve as sole administrative agent (in such capacity, the “Administrative Agent”) and collateral agent under the DIP Facility and the Exit Revolving Facility (in such capacities, the “Agents”) and (b) JPMCB shall appear on the “left” of all marketing and other materials in connection with the DIP Facility and the Exit Revolving Facility and will have the rights and responsibilities customarily associated with such name placement. No other arrangers, bookrunners, managers, agents or co-agents with respect to the DIP Facility or the Exit Revolving Facility will be appointed unless you and JPMCB so agree. Notwithstanding, anything to the contrary herein, Tailored shall not be prohibited from obtaining additional commitments or modifying such commitments as appropriate with respect to the Exit Revolving Facility such that the aggregate amount of commitments under the Exit Revolving Facility is not in excess of $430,000,000 and awarding arranger, bookrunner, manager, agent or co-agent titles in connection therewith.

 

The Lead Arranger reserves the right, prior to, on or after the Effective Date to syndicate all or a portion of the Initial Lenders’ commitments hereunder to one or more banks or other financial institutions reasonably acceptable to you (such acceptance not to be unreasonably withheld, delayed, conditioned or denied) that will become parties to the Form DIP Credit Agreement pursuant to syndications to be managed by the Lead Arranger and reasonably satisfactory to you (the banks, financial institutions or other institutional lenders and investors becoming parties to the Form DIP Credit Agreement, together with the Initial Lenders, being collectively referred to as the “Lenders”); provided that, notwithstanding the Lead Arranger’s right to syndicate the DIP Facility and receive commitments with respect thereto and except as provided herein, (i) no Initial Lender shall be relieved, released or novated from its obligations hereunder (including its obligation to fund any portion of the DIP Facility on the Effective Date, subject to the satisfaction (or waiver) of the conditions set forth in Section 5 below and in Article IV of the Form DIP Credit Agreement and its obligation to convert into the Exit Revolving Facility on the Conversion Date, subject to the satisfaction (or waiver) of the conditions set forth in the section titled “Conditions Precedent to the Conversion Date” in the Exit Facility Term Sheet) in connection with any syndication, assignment or participation of the DIP Facility, including its commitments hereunder in respect thereof, until after the Effective Date has occurred, (ii) no assignment or novation by any Initial Lender shall become effective as between you and such Initial Lender with respect to all or any portion of such Initial Lender’s commitments in respect of the DIP Facility until after the occurrence of the Effective Date and (iii) unless you otherwise agree in writing, each Initial Lender shall retain exclusive control over all rights and obligations with respect to its commitments in respect of the DIP Facility, including all rights with respect to consents, modifications, supplements, waivers and amendments, until the Effective Date has occurred.

 

From the date hereof until the Effective Date, you agree to actively assist the Lead Arranger in completing a syndication reasonably satisfactory to us and you. Such assistance shall be limited to (a) your using commercially reasonable efforts to ensure that the syndication efforts benefit materially from your existing lending relationships, (b) facilitating direct contact (which meetings may take place remotely through electronic platforms mutually agreed upon) between appropriate senior management and advisors of Tailored and prospective Lenders, in all cases at reasonable times and frequencies to be mutually agreed upon, (c) the hosting, with the Lead Arranger, of no more than one meeting with prospective Lenders at times to be mutually agreed (which meetings may take place remotely through electronic platforms mutually agreed upon) and (d) as set forth in the next paragraph, assisting in the preparation of materials to be used in connection with the syndication.

5.                   Conditions.

 

The Commitment Parties’ Commitments and agreements hereunder in respect of the DIP Facility are subject solely to (i) the entry of the Interim Order (as defined in the Form DIP Credit Agreement) by the Court on or before the date that is five (5) days after the Petition Date seeking to approve the DIP Facility and (ii) the satisfaction (or waiver) of the conditions precedent set forth in the sections of Article IV of the Form DIP Credit Agreement on and as of the Effective Date. There are no conditions (implied or otherwise) to the Commitments hereunder in respect of the DIP Facility, and there will be no conditions (implied or otherwise) to the availability of the DIP Facility on the Effective Date, including compliance with the terms of this Commitment Letter, the Fee Letters or the Form DIP Credit Agreement, other than those that are expressly stated or referenced in this Section 5. The Commitment Parties’ Commitments and agreements hereunder in respect of the Exit Revolving Facility are subject solely to the satisfaction (or waiver) of the conditions precedent set forth in the section titled “Conditions Precedent to the Conversion Date” in the Exit Facility Term Sheet (as defined in the Form DIP Credit Agreement). There are no conditions (implied or otherwise) to the Commitments hereunder in respect of the Exit Revolving Facility, and there will be no conditions (implied or otherwise) to the availability of the Exit Revolving Facility on the Conversion Date, including compliance with the terms of this Commitment Letter, the Fee Letters or the Exit Facility Term Sheet, other than those that are expressly stated or referenced in this Section 5.
